Summary

The Data Quality Analyst is responsible for ensuring that all data products delivered on the Microsoft Fabric platform are accurate, reliable, and fully aligned with business objectives defined through the Goal–Question–Metrics (GQM) model. This role validates data quality across the Medallion architecture (Bronze, Silver, and Gold) by applying CAE’s Data Platform Coding Framework to perform end-to-end testing of data acquisition flows. It also ensures that data products comply with governance standards through Microsoft Purview, including the evaluation of metadata, lineage, and data security controls.

Acting as a key bridge between business and technical teams, the Data Quality Analyst manages defects, verifies performance and data integrity, and drives continuous improvement to ensure that analytics outputs are trusted, auditable, and enable effective data-driven decision-making.
